Terrell Owens: The Iconic Spark
T.O. only played 21 games for the Eagles, but each one was unforgettable.
-
2004 Season: 77 receptions, 1,200 yards, 14 TDs — in just 14 games
-
Played Super Bowl XXXIX with a fractured leg, catching 9 passes for 122 yards
-
Brought swagger, media attention, and attitude to a team chasing a title

He was elite, but his exit — marred by drama with Donovan McNabb and front office disputes — left fans wondering what could’ve been.
A.J. Brown: The Franchise Foundation
A.J. Brown arrived via trade in 2022 and immediately became the heartbeat of the Eagles offense.
-
Broke the franchise record for single-season receiving yards (1,496)
-
Multiple 1,000-yard seasons, consistent WR1 production in both real football and fantasy
-
Trusted target for Jalen Hurts, particularly in high-pressure moments
-
Known for work ethic, physicality, and quiet leadership
